Dick Vermeil is best known for his legendary NFL coaching career that netted him a Super Bowl title. These days the Coach is making some delicious wines under his own label.  It is easy to think that Dick Vermeil might be using his football fame to sell wine. That is not the case with this celebrity. Dick Vermeil was born and raised in the Napa Valley. His family and the Frediani family of Calistoga vineyard fame were very close. The Frediani family owns 200 acres in the Calistoga AVA. These grapes are highly prized and there is a waiting list to buy Zinfandel, Cabernet and Charbono. Dick Vermeil’s close friendship with the Freidiani family nets him a good share of these vines. The wines are well made, delicious, and high end.  Thomas Brown is the winemaker, and he is one of the best in the Napa Valley. We suggest you try the Charbono for sure. Charbono is a grape that was a favorite long ago in the Napa Valley. Today, there are a small amount of acres of Charbono planted in the Napa Valley. These grapes make a tasty and food-friendly wine. Think grilled beef. The Vermeil wine tasting room is at 1255 Lincoln Avenue in downtown Calistoga. The tasting room is open Sunday to Thursday, 10AM – 5:30PM, and Friday & Saturday 10AM – 8PM. Besides tasting wine, football buffs can peruse the Vermeil coaching memorabilia. Sip some wine and look back at one of the greatest coaching careers in NFL history.
